From mboxrd@z Thu Jan 1 00:00:00 1970 From: Martin Wilck Subject: Re: [PATCH 1/2] libmultipath: hwhandler auto-detection for ALUA Date: Thu, 12 Apr 2018 17:43:39 +0200 Message-ID: <1523547819.4346.17.camel@suse.com> References: <20180327215053.3631-1-mwilck@suse.com> <20180327215053.3631-2-mwilck@suse.com> <20180403203132.GF3103@octiron.msp.redhat.com> <1522788809.3801.109.camel@suse.com> <20180403212958.GH3103@octiron.msp.redhat.com> <1522829076.3955.24.camel@suse.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: In-Reply-To: <1522829076.3955.24.camel@suse.com>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: dm-devel-bounces@redhat.com Errors-To: dm-devel-bounces@redhat.com To: Benjamin Marzinski Cc: dm-devel@redhat.com, Xose Vazquez Perez , Hannes List-Id: dm-devel.ids SGkgQmVuLAoKT24gV2VkLCAyMDE4LTA0LTA0IGF0IDEwOjA0ICswMjAwLCBNYXJ0aW4gV2lsY2sg d3JvdGU6Cj4gT24gVHVlLCAyMDE4LTA0LTAzIGF0IDE2OjI5IC0wNTAwLCBCZW5qYW1pbiBNYXJ6 aW5za2kgd3JvdGU6Cgo+ID4gPiBJIGJlbGlldmUgdGhhdCBpZiBUR1BTIGlzIDAsIHRoZSBkZXZp Y2Ugd2lsbCBuZXZlciBiZSBhYmxlIHRvCj4gPiA+IHN1cHBvcnQKPiA+ID4gQUxVQS4gVGhlIGtl cm5lbCBhbHNvIGxvb2tzIGF0IHRoZSBUUEdTIGJpdHMgYW5kIHdvbid0IHRyeSBBTFVBCj4gPiA+ IGlmCj4gPiA+IHRoZXkKPiA+ID4gYXJlIHVuc2V0LiBPbmNlIHRoZSBkZXZpY2UgaXMgY29uZmln dXJlZCBhbmQgYWN0dWFsIEFMVUEKPiA+ID4gUlRQRy9TVFBHCj4gPiA+IGNhbGxzIGFyZSBwZXJm b3JtZWQsIHRoZXkgbWF5IGZhaWwgZm9yIGEgdmFyaWV0eSBvZiB0ZW1wb3JhcnkKPiA+ID4gcmVh c29ucyAtCj4gPiA+IEkgd2FudGVkIHRvIGF2b2lkIHJlc2V0dGluZyB0aGUgcHJpbyBhbGdvcml0 aG0gdG8gImNvbnN0IiBmb3IKPiA+ID4gc3VjaAo+ID4gPiBjYXNlcy4gVGhhdCdzIG15IHVuZGVy c3RhbmRpbmcsIGNvcnJlY3QgbWUgaWYgSSdtIHdyb25nLgo+ID4gCj4gPiBEZXZpY2VzIHRoYXQg d2VyZSBub3QgY29ycmVjdGx5IHN1cHBvcmluZyBBTFVBIHJldHVybmVkID4gMCBmb3IKPiA+IGdl dF90YXJnZXRfcG9ydF9ncm91cF9zdXBwb3J0LCBzbyBkZXRlY3RfYWx1YSBhY3R1YWxseSBkb2Vz IGFsbCB0aGUKPiA+IHdvcmsKPiA+IG5lY2Vzc2FyeSB0byB2ZXJpZnkgdGhhdCBpdCBjYW4gZ2V0 IGEgcHJpb3JpdHkuIFdpdGhvdXQgZG9pbmcgdGhpcywKPiA+IG11bHRpcGxlIGRldmllY3MgdGhh dCBkaWRuJ3Qgc3VwcG9ydCBBTFVBIHdlcmUgYmVpbmcgZGV0ZWN0ZWQgYXMKPiA+IHN1cHBvcnRp bmcgQUxVQS4KPiAKPiBTbywgZGV0ZWN0X2FsdWEoKSB0ZXN0cyBUUEdTICphbmQqIHRyaWVzIGFu ZCBhY3R1YWwgYWx1YSBjYWxsLCBhbmQKPiBzZXRzCj4gcHAtPnRwZ3MgdG8gYW55dGhpbmcgb3Ro ZXIgdGhhbiBUUEdTX05PTkUgb25seSBpZiB0aGUgbGF0dGVyIGlzCj4gc3VjY2Vzc2Z1bC4gVGhh dCdzIGZpbmUuIE15IHBhdGNoIHdhcyBsb29raW5nIGF0IHBwLT50cGdzLCBzbyBpdCB3YXMKPiBp bXBsaWNpdGx5IHVzaW5nIHRoaXMgbG9naWMgb2YgZGV0ZWN0X2FsdWEoKS4gQnV0IGRvZXMgdGhh dCBndWFyYW50ZWUKPiB0aGF0IGZ1dHVyZSBhbHVhLT5nZXRwcmlvKCkgY2FsbHMgd2lsbCBuZXZl ciBmYWlsIGF0IHNvbWUgbGF0ZXIgcG9pbnQKPiBpbiB0aW1lPwo+IAo+IE1heWJlIEkgbWlzdW5k ZXJzdG9vZCB5b3VyIG9yaWdpbmFsIHByb3Bvc2l0aW9uLiBXaGF0IEknbSBzYXlpbmcgaXMKPiB0 aGF0IHJlc2V0dGluZyB0aGUgcHJpbyBhbGdvcml0aG0gZnJvbSAiYWx1YSIgdG8gImNvbnN0IiBi ZWNhdXNlIG9mCj4gYW4KPiBlcnJvciBjb2RlIGluIGdldF9wcmlvKCkgaXMgd3JvbmcsIGJlY2F1 c2UgdGhhdCBlcnJvciBjb2RlIG1heSBiZQo+IHRyYW5zaWVudC4KPiAKPiBJZiB3ZSBnaXZlICJo YXJkd2FyZV9oYW5kbGVyIiBjb25maWcgb3B0aW9ucyBwcmVmZXJlbmNlIG92ZXIgQUxVQQo+IGF1 dG9kZXRlY3Rpb24sIGFuZCB0aHVzIGVuZm9yY2UgaHdoYW5kbGVyICIxIGFsdWEiIG9uIHN1Y2gg ZGV2aWNlcwo+IHRoYXQKPiBoYXZlIG5vIEFMVUEgc3VwcG9ydCwgZG9tYXAoKSBpcyBndWFyYW50 ZWVkIHRvIGZhaWwsIGJlY2F1c2UgdGhlCj4ga2VybmVsCj4gcmVmdXNlcyB0byBzZXQgdXAgYSBt YXAgd2l0aCBhIGdpdmVuIGh3aGFuZGxlciBpZiBhbnkgZGV2aWNlIGRvZXNuJ3QKPiBzdXBwb3J0 IHRoYXQgaGFuZGxlci4KPiAKPiA+IEJ5IHVzaW5nIHJldGFpbl9hdHRhY2hlZF9od2hhbmRsZXIg YXQgYWxsLCB3ZSBhcmUgaW1wbGljaXRseQo+ID4gcmVxdWlyaW5nCj4gPiB0aGUgc2NzaV9kaF9h bHVhIG1vZHVsZSB0byBiZSBsb2FkZWQgYmVmb3JlIGRldmljZXMgd2l0aAo+ID4gaW5kZXRlcm1p bmF0ZQo+ID4gY29uZmlndXJhdGlvbnMgYXJlIGRpc2NvdmVyZWQgZm9yIHRoZW0gdG8gd29yayBj b3JyZWN0bHkuIHJpZ2h0Pwo+ID4gRm9yCj4gPiBpbnN0YW5jZSwgY29tbWl0IDcxNWM0OGQ5M2Rk MDA5MzA1MzRjZTZhNTVkMGUzNzA1NDY2ZGY1ZDYgZGlkIHRoaXMKPiA+IGZvcgo+ID4gbmV0YXBw IGRldmljZXMsIGFuZCB0aGF0IHdhcyBpbiAyMDEzLiBJIGRvbid0IHNlZSBob3cgdGhpcyBpcwo+ ID4gZGlmZmVyZW50Lgo+IAo+IFlvdSdyZSByaWdodCwgd2UgYXJlICJpbXBsaWNpdGx5IHJlcXVp cmluZyIgdGhpcyBzb3J0LW9mLCBidXQgd2UgaGF2ZQo+IG5vIGNvZGUgdGhhdCBlbmZvcmNlcyB0 aGUgZWFybHkgbG9hZGluZyBvZiB0aGUgZGV2aWNlIGhhbmRsZXJzLiBXZQo+IHNob3VsZCBiZSBz aGlwcGluZyBhIG1vZHVsZXMtbG9hZC5kIGZpbGUsIG9yIGEgbW9kcHJvYmUuZCBzb2Z0ZGVwLCBv cgo+IHNvbWV0aGluZyBzaW1pbGFyIHRoYXQgd291bGQgZW5mb3JjZSB0aGlzIHNldHRpbmcgaWYg d2UgX3JlYWxseV8KPiBkZXBlbmQKPiBvbiBpdC4gIkltcGxpY2l0IHJlcXVpcmVtZW50cyIgYXJl IGJhZC4gV2Ugc2hvdWxkIGVpdGhlciBtYWtlIHRoZQo+IHJlcXVpcmVtZW50IGV4cGxpY2l0LCBv ciBub3QgaGFyZC1kZXBlbmQgb24gaXQuIFNvIGZhciBJIHdhcyB0aGlua2luZwo+IHRoZSBsYXR0 ZXIuIEFmdGVyIGFsbCwgU0NTSSBkZXZpY2UtaGFuZGxlciBzdXBwb3J0IGlzIGNvbmZpZ3VyYWJs ZSBpbgo+IHRoZSBrZXJuZWwuCgpJJ20gdW5zdXJlIHdoYXQgdG8gZG8uIERvIHlvdSBzdGlsbCBy ZWplY3QgbXkgcGF0Y2g/IE9yIGhhdmUgeW91IGJlZW4KY29udmluY2VkIGJ5IEhhbm5lcyBhbmQg bXkgYXJndW1lbnRzPyAKT3IgYXJlIHlvdSByZXF1ZXN0aW5nIGNoYW5nZXM/IElmIHllcywgd2hh dD8gCgpSZWdhcmRzLApNYXJ0aW4KCi0tIApEci4gTWFydGluIFdpbGNrIDxtd2lsY2tAc3VzZS5j b20+LCBUZWwuICs0OSAoMCk5MTEgNzQwNTMgMjEwNwpTVVNFIExpbnV4IEdtYkgsIEdGOiBGZWxp eCBJbWVuZMO2cmZmZXIsIEphbmUgU21pdGhhcmQsIEdyYWhhbSBOb3J0b24KSFJCIDIxMjg0IChB RyBOw7xybmJlcmcpCgotLQpkbS1kZXZlbCBtYWlsaW5nIGxpc3QKZG0tZGV2ZWxAcmVkaGF0LmNv bQpodHRwczovL3d3dy5yZWRoYXQuY29tL21haWxtYW4vbGlzdGluZm8vZG0tZGV2ZWw=